ProE野火版二次开发入门指南:环境配置与高级功能详解

需积分: 10 0 下载量 28 浏览量 更新于2024-07-23 收藏 2.23MB PDF 举报
《PROE二次开发入门》是一本由作者王伟编写的教程,针对ProE野火版(Pro/ENGINEER Wildfire)的ProToolKit进行深入讲解,旨在帮助读者掌握该软件的二次开发技术,从入门到进阶。本书适合对Pro/E有深厚兴趣,希望提升其在设计过程中效率和定制化能力的专业人士。 本书首先介绍了环境配置部分,区分了野火2.0版本搭配VC++6.0.6和野火4.0版本搭配VS2005.11两种不同的开发环境设置,确保读者根据自身实际需求选择合适的工具。接着,章节详细介绍了菜单的创建,包括普通菜单、浮动菜单和右键菜单的编写,以及如何通过热键指定快捷键。 对象的基本操作是后续章节的核心内容,涵盖了信息输入/输出、选择对象(单选、多选、框选和自动选择)、载入对象,以及对象元素的遍历和LOG文件的使用。此外,还重点讲解了参数、尺寸和关系式的操作,如参数操作、尺寸管理,以及利用函数指针进行高级控制。书中还提供了一个综合实例——齿轮的参数化设计,展示了这些理论在实际设计中的应用。 装配管理是重要的实用技能,包括装配的选择、ProAsmcomppath的理解、自动装配和元素干涉检查。接下来,作者指导读者如何创建User Defined Functions (UDF) —— 用户自定义特征,并在PART和Group环境下调用,扩展Pro/E的功能。 工程图部分介绍了表格、符号的使用,以及如何处理装配模型的工程图,包括导出不同格式的图纸。此外,作者还涉及了Pro/E系统的UI界面设计,展示了VC界面的特点,以及如何利用各种数据库工具,如INI、TXT、Excel和ACCESS,来创建系统配置和微型数据库,提升工作效率。 最后,书中还包含三个工程专题:团队公用函数库的建立、元件库的创建、螺丝系统的设计以及自动化打印功能的实现,这些都是在实际项目中非常实用且可以提高工作效率的关键技能。 《PROE二次开发入门》是一本全面而实用的指南,不仅适合初学者学习Pro/ENGINEER ProToolKit的二次开发基础,也适合有一定经验的工程师进一步深化理解并提升他们的Pro/E技能。